Plant Details Botanical Name: Rhododendron 'Pearce's American Beauty' Common Name: Pearces American Beauty Rhododendron Size & Growth: 4-6 ft tall, 3-4 ft wide; slow to moderate growth Hardiness Zones: 6-9 Foliage Type: Evergreen Bloom Time: Late Spring to Early Summer Growth Rate: Slow to Moderate Light Requirements: Part Shade to Full Shade Attracts Pollinators: Bees, hummingbirds Indoor Friendly: Not suitable for indoor growth Container Friendly: Yes, with proper drainage Deer Resistant: Yes Pet Warning: Toxic to pets if ingested Fragrant: Yes Cut Flower: Suitable for floral arrangements Grows Well With: Ferns, hostas, azaleas Care Tips Planting Instructions: Plant in well-drained, acidic soil in part shade. Keep soil consistently moist. Soil Moisture: Moist but well-drained Soil Type: Acidic, well-drained Humidity: Prefers moderate to high humidity Pruning Instructions: Remove spent flowers and deadwood after blooming to promote healthy growth. Winter Care: Protect with mulch in colder zones, minimal pruning in winter Planting Depth: Set root ball at soil level Fertilization: Use acid-loving plant fertilizer in early spring Special Care: Mulch to maintain soil acidity, avoid heavy pruning
